Hey i just bought a brand new cadillac cts with a bose audio system.... and the sub in the back is already making noises. What happens is when i turn the volume up past a certain point the sub makes a tapping noise every time it vibrates... I was wondering if my speakers are blown or if the sub is just loose and it is tapping the plastic. And if my sub is blown would i have to by a brand new sub or just get it fixed if possible?

Sorry; but NO; they're NOT blown.
A blown speaker means the surround (foam part) is ripped. This means the speaker will usually make noise WHENEVER it is used; because it is no longer centered in the speaker cone. If the speaker only makes noises at high volume; the cone (moving part) it bottoming out on the coil. If this is part of a box+Amp package; turn the boost on the amp down in small increments until the bottoming out stops. |
